Pair of Antique Victorian/Edwardian Stained Glass Window Panels
Beautiful matching pair of leaded stained glass panels featuring a classic geometric design with central bullseye rondels — one in rich amber and one in vibrant green.
Each panel has elegant pointed petal motifs and clear textured glass, typical of late 19th/early 20th century British or Continental architecture. Perfect for a transom, door, or as decorative wall art.
Dimensions: 39cm high and 34,5cm width
Condition: Good antique condition with nice patina, some natural age wear and minor lead lines consistent with age.
A lovely, authentic piece of architectural heritage that catches the light beautifully!
